231 Front Street, Lahaina, HI 96761 info@givingpress.com 808.123.4567

Month: September 2018

Computer Running Slow? How To Help Your Slow Computer and Make It Run Faster

Are you using a computer that is running slow? Do you want it to run like it was brand new? If you want to make your computer run as fast as it should be then here are some tips on how you can do it:

1. One way you can effectively boost your computer's performance is to reformat your entire hard drive. This method will erase all of your previous faulty installed programs and will give you a blank slate in which you can start over again.

The problem with this method is that it can be a very long and tedious process. And if you're not familiar on how to do the reformatting yourself you will have to pay a computer technician to do it for you. Remember that before you reformat your computer, to always make backup copies of your important files.

2. Another way you can speed up your slow computer is by using system restore. This method is better than reformatting because you will not lose any of your files. The system restore function in your windows operating system works by bringing the state of your computer back in time, back to before there were any errors. You can find the system restore feature under start – programs – Accessories – system tools.

3. Probably the best way you can speed up your computer is by fixing your windows registry. The registry is like the brain of your operating system, as it tells the programs and hardware installed as to what to do. Every bit of software and hardware installed in your computer gets recorded in the registry. Before a program starts it gets its instruction from the registry first. But when the registry gets clogged with errors the computer will have a hard time knowing what to do, resulting in a computer running slow.

Fixing the registry by yourself can be risky, most especially if you do not have a clue as to what you need to do. If you make one wrong move then you'd be in deep trouble. Luckily, there are system and registry scanners that you can use to make the task of repairing your computer's registry a whole lot simpler.

By doing this you no longer need to scan each and every one of the entries in your registry, if you have a fairly old computer then it could literally take you hours to sort through it all. A system scanner will do all of the tedious tasks for you and even fix them. Now you no longer have an excuse for using a slow computer. Scan your computer now and stop your computer running slow and get it back to its optimal running condition. …

Google Go Vs Objective C

1. Introduction

The significance of language for the evolution of culture lies in this, that mankind set up in language a separate world beside the other world, a place it took to be so firmly set that, standing upon it, it could lift the rest of the world off its hinges and make itself master of it. To the extent that man has for long ages believed in the concepts and names of things as in aeternae veritates he has appropriated to himself that pride by which he raised himself above the animal: he really thought that in language he possessed knowledge of the world.” Fredrick Nietzsche.

Every computer programmer has few comments on how his programming language of choice is the best. There are common attributes that most programmers want, like an easy to use syntax, better run-time performance, faster compilation and there are more particular functionalities that we need depending on our application. These are the main reasons why there are so many programming languages and a new one being introduced almost daily. Despite the large amount of interest and attention on language design, many modern programming languages don’t always offer innovation in language design for example Microsoft and Apple offer only variations of it.

It is not too far in the history when C stepped into the world of computing and became the basis of many other successful programming languages. Most of the members of this family stayed close to their infamous mother and very few managed to break away and distinguish themselves as an individual being. The computing landscape however, has changed considerably since the birth of C. Computers are thousands of times faster utilizing multi-core processors. Internet and web access are widely available and the devices are getting smaller and smaller and mobile computing has been pushed to the mainstream. In this era, we want a language that makes our life better and easier.

According to TIOBE Index, Go and objective C were amongst fastest growing languages specially in 2009 and Go was awarded “Programming Language of the Year” in the very same year. TIOBE obtain its results on a monthly basis by indexing. Indexing is updated using the data obtained by the links to certified programmers, training and software vendors. This data is assembled for TIOBE via the Google, Bing, Yahoo, Wikipedia and YouTube search engines. The results was more predictable for Objective C as it is the language of the iPhone and Mac, and Apple is running strong in the market. However, this result gets more interesting because it has not been long since the technology darling introduced her own programming language called GO.

2. A Little Bit Of History

Go’s infamous mother Google has dominated search, e-mail and more. So the introduction of a new programming language is not a shocker! Like many of Google’s open source projects, Go began life as a 20 percent time project which Google gives to its staff to experiment, and later evolved into something …

Automated Language Translation Software and Its Quality

Many people looking to have their business documents ported to a different dialect often avoid automated translation software. Having little confidence in software’s ability to perform a suitable translation, they prefer to work with expensive human interpreters to do the job.

Truth is, businesses can save a lot of money with a small investment in translation software. Instead of having all their documents worked on by a consultant, they can use the automated software to handle common translation needs, leaving the expensive manual work done for documents that can seriously affect the bottom line.

If you compare manual translations with their automated counterparts, it’s easy to see the difference in quality. Since human translators are capable of a wider range of thought processes, their work will naturally be better. However, peruse them for their ability to communicate the ideas and the overall value will likely be the same.

Modern language translation software no longer use the word-per-word conversions older software used to do. Instead, new algorithms offer pretty advanced features that may surprise you with its quality. For well-written source documents, especially, the translation into any new language can be quite impressive.

Don’t discount translation software based on past experience. They’ve now evolved in massive ways and might prove to be among the most valuable tools you can buy for your organization.

Besides, you can save more time, effort and expenses especially when you are in a hurry to finish the job. You can leave it there if you want to, with just minutes or seconds, the automated language translation softaware will do the task and finish it in an instant.…

Differences Between Microsoft Word 2003 and Microsoft Word 2007 – An Overview

Microsoft Word being one among the most widely used Microsoft applications allows users to write and create, view, copy, paste, save, edit, share, and print text documents etc. Microsoft Word application rules the word-processing market as it allows users to beautify their text documents by inserting pictures and animated images, charts, diagrams, tables, figures, and shapes etc.; and by using text in different styles, fonts, colors, and languages etc. at the same time. Since its launch, Microsoft Word has greatly reduced users’ burden of creating multiple documents at a time, copying them to another word file, and running grammar & spell-check function etc. With the time, Microsoft Word (MS-Word) also progressed to new versions such as MS-Word 2003 and 2007. Below are some of the significant features that distinguish MS-Word 2007 and MS-Word 2007:

Interface:

Microsoft-Word 2003 – It comprises several menu tabs as well as tool bars that include lots of buttons. These buttons/features can be customized to give command access.

Microsoft-Word 2007 – It uses a user-friendly interface known as ‘Ribbon’. It comprises 7 menu tabs viz. ‘Home’, ‘Page Layout’, ‘References’, ‘Mailings’, ‘Review’, and ‘View’. There is an 8th tab also called ‘Developer’ that is however turned off by the default settings. Every Ribbon tab contains different buttons along with drop down menus. However, compared to MS-Word 2003, the Ribbon interface in MS-Word 2007 is not customizable.

File Format:

MS-Word 2003 – It uses DOC file format for saving text documents. However, users will have to download a compatibility pack for opening DOCX files.

MS-Word 2007 – It uses DOCX file format, which is an open XML standard format. It is the widely used file format for opening XML files. The users also have the choice of saving their documents/files in DOC format.

Document Inspector:

MS-Word 2003 -It comprises ‘Remove Hidden Data’ add-in, which is a tool to remove document’s hidden or visible information including personal etc. However, the add-in does not a user make changes to document’s properties.

MS-Word 2007 – It comprises ‘Inspect Document’ command that is when executed gives a list of options including versions, comments, annotations, document properties, customized XML data, personal information, or revisions among others. The Inspect Document feature allows users to delete above mentioned options as per their requirements.

Quick Parts:

MS-Word 2003 – It comprises ‘AutoText’ function that enables users to define, edit, insert, and save text.

MS-Word 2007 – It comprises ‘Quick Parts’ that allows users to remain its text plain or add formatting or graphics. The feature will be available in ‘Insert’ tab.

Quick Access Toolbar:

Word 2003 – It comprises no such feature and a user has to go through the entire menu tab to get access to its frequently-used commands such as save, edit, or undo etc.

Word 2007 – It comprises ‘Quick Access Toolbar’ that is designed to save the commands used again and again overly by a user while creating a text document. Such commands or features could be anything from undo, repeat, clip …

Pros and Cons of Free Public Wi-Fi

With the busy way of life people have nowadays, it seems crucial to stay connected with your loved ones and business partners wherever you go. There are lots of things you may plan to do during a day and you often have to keep everything under control. This concerns both home duties and job assignments. The round-the-clock availability of the Internet can do many things easier. You won’t have to watch the time to be in the office to hold a conference, for example. Just take a laptop and make sure you will be able to find free and reliable Wi-Fi to join the meeting on time. Likewise, you may travel abroad and take your smartphone, tablet or laptop with you to get in touch with your loved ones any time you need by launching to free public Wi-Fi hotspot. With that said, it becomes understandable, why the prevailing amount of cities across the globe tend to organize free zones for the local residents and the tourists. However, is the technology so reliable and safe as it seems to be? Let us have a closer look at the pros and cons of this technology below.

Positive Aspects of Free City Wi-Fi

As mentioned above, free public Wi-Fi makes it possible for people from different corners of the world to stay connected on the go any time of the day. This is surely one of the major benefits of this technology. Among other merits of the technology, it also makes sense to point out the following:

  • Enhanced traveling experience (the opportunity to check your e-mail, talk or exchange messages with people you love and miss)
  • Business advantages (if you have to hold an urgent conference, meeting or presentation, but are really pressed for time, you can do that from any place, where Wi-Fi services are provided for free)
  • The chance to plan your day wisely (you don’t have to postpone personal or business tasks if you have an opportunity to launch to the Wi-Fi network anywhere you need)
  • 24/7 availability, which means that there are dozens (if not hundreds) of free Wi-Fi hotspots almost in any town. So, why don’t you take a chance to make use of them when needed? That is an undeniable benefit, indeed!

Listed above are only several pros of this advanced technique. Now, it is high time to discuss the cons of the option to realize what to be ready for.

Negative Aspects of Using Free Wi-Fi in Public Places

We have already noted that most cities of the world offer free Wi-Fi nowadays and millions of people use the service without realizing the potential negative aftereffects they may face. Some of the negative aspects include:

  • The necessity for the owners of coffee houses, restaurants and other places that offer free Wi-Fi to handle a number of technical and financial problems. This is triggered by the fact that setting up the network with numerous access points is not an easy task, which requires the handling of

Gadgets To Watch at Best Buy Outlets During Black Friday 2010

One of the most interesting and exciting holiday shopping of the year belongs to Black Friday sales event. Several store outlets will open before the sun increases to offer several discounted items such as laptops, mobile phones, HDTVs, clothing, jewelries and many more.

Among the most popular store gadgets fans should look at is Best Buy station. Perhaps, the store has at least 1 near your neighborhood so there's no chance that you'll miss it! For the Best Buy Black Friday 2010 event, the shop is expected to offer gadgets and electronic products such as tablet PCs and ginormous HDTVs from popular brands like Sony, Panasonic, Samsung and LG. For smartphone brands, expect to see HTC, Samsung, BlackBerry and T-Mobile line-ups.

For wise shoppers, this is the time of the year to spend and get the latest gadgetry. You could, of course, buy after the product's latest release but in my opinion that would be impractical to say the least. With Black Friday sales, you can maximize the value of your money – which is good considering that our economy is not on its tip-top shape this year.

One of the trends in our day and age are tablet PCs. Perhaps you are very familiar with Apple's iPad as well as the craze that went on for months because of this device. Well, it only made Steve Jobs and Apple several billion dollars richer than the rest of us. Now, there are gadget manufacturers who want to take a piece of Apple's profit by creating their own tablet device. And one of the most popular is the Samsung Galaxy Tab.

The good news is that the Galaxy Tab is rumored to be going on sale at Best Buy come Black Friday of this year at a very competitive price (compared with the iPad). There are 2 versions of it – the Wi-fi and the 3G model with a month-to-month contract plan with Verizon. This Android-powered device will certainly be a hit among individuals who are looking for a good iPad alternative (both price and performance point of view). The iPad may look superior because of its status but as you know there is a lot of room for improvements which other tablet creations can take advantage.

So, if you are itching to go and buy a new HDTV, smartphone or a slate device right now I advise you to be patient, save your money and wait a little while. For sure, more deals and offers will be disclosed in the coming days as we approach the big shopping spree. …

How to Remove Fake Antivirus Software

There is a proliferation of fake antivirus programs nowadays. The developers of these rouge programs are exploiting the existing security fears of almost all computer users. That is why you need to equip yourself with the right knowledge on how to remove fake antivirus software from your computer. But before you can delete fake antivirus software, you have to understand its specific behavior.

Get Rid of Rogue Antivirus by Knowing It Thoroughly

A rogue antivirus program can sneak into your computer’s system through several channels. First, it can be transferred from an infected removable USB stick to your PC. You may also have downloaded a dubious toolbar that automatically installs the fake antivirus. The most common form of transmission is by using torrent sites or peer-to-peer downloads.

Such virus normally mimics the behavior of the built-in security center installed in your computer. If you are running on Windows, the fake virus will imitate the appearance and dialog boxes of the Windows Security Center.

Once installed, the bogus antivirus will warn you about virus and malware infections. Pop-ups and nag screens will appear instructing you to download and purchase a new antivirus application. In reality, there are no real malwares or viruses in your PC. The only infection is coming from the fake antivirus software.

If you will not uninstall bogus antivirus software, your web browser can be hijacked. Your computer will also run very slowly. Worse, you will be exposed to phishing scams and identity theft.

The Easy Way to Delete Fake Antivirus Software

You can remove rogue antivirus software manually. However, this is a risky option especially if you are not too familiar with your system files and computer registry. You can damage your system if you accidentally delete a wrong file.

The best and easiest option is to remove bogus antivirus software automatically. This involves the use of a reliable malware removal tool. Remember that even highly experienced computer users are looking for information on how to get rid of such software automatically. They seek the help Internet security services to delete the virus from their computers.

In order to avoid harming your system and to completely eliminate the such fake software from your machine, you should follow the solutions and approaches implemented by most computer users. You must get the most reliable and updated information about rouge software. It is also important to learn how to remove fake antivirus software using an automated anti-malware tool.…

Turn Your Blog Marketing Into a Profitable Business

Blog marketing is often a hobby for some people while others turn their blog into a full time income. Most decisions are personal but it’s your choice long term about making your blog a profitable business or simply making it about your hobby to share with whomever subscribes.

Everyone has their own reasons when choosing to blog. Either it’s their own hobby just for fun while the next guy prefers to turn it into a cash cow. We like the idea of doing whatever you want to do with your blog, whatever makes you happy to be a blogger.

When we think about blogging for profit Vs a hobby it takes on a different type of concern. Blogging for profit drives the blogger to think about his/her subscribers, who’s reading your blog, then the sales dollars coming into your bank account.

The “hobby” blogger is not concerned with all the details, his/her goal is to blog about whatever new ideas or discoveries they can share with their subscribers on the email list.

Actually, blog marketing is an ongoing challenge. You never come to the finish line with nothing more to do or say. Links to your blog, leaving comments on other blogs, is part of the daily or weekly activity for the blogger that must be done.

Learning and understanding SEO, search engine optimization, is another important piece of the puzzle needed to be a successful blogger. Higher search engine results are important to get the attention of more people who are looking for your type of products or information.

Bloggers, both profitable and hobby blogs, need to have RSS feeds that will allow other bloggers to link to your blog. Links from others are a huge part of blog marketing success. When someone uses the RSS feeds from your blog, they are able to receive your posts. When they post your blog post to their own blog or website, you’ll get a link back from their blog or website. Can be a little confusing until you get the hang of this blogging procedure.

Blog marketing entails many things to do before you’ll see the results or successes you desire. Income or hobby is your choice, however, learning the “how to” make it all fit together in a way that will guide your future success as a blogger is the beginners challenge.

Be sure that you are using the best techniques available or you’ll end up wasting a lot of time and money. An old saying… “haste makes waste”… is probably good advice for all bloggers. Take your time to begin your new blog and enjoy the venture as a blogger.…

Linked Lists – What They Are and How to Use Them

Most, if not all, programmers have at least heard of a linked list. If you have not then you are about to. In this article I will be outlining what exactly a linked list is, the advantages of using one, and I will try to do this in the simplest terms that I can.

So, lets get to the point. When you are programming, it is a very common occurrence that you want to keep track of a list or set of data. The easiest way to do this is with an array. Whether it is a single dimensional, or more gridlike 2-3 dimensional array, it will typically suite your needs just fine.

But, what do you do when you have an array of say, a million items. Naturally this is going to take up quite a bit of memory. Still, an array will probably do the job just fine. So now lets look at Object Oriented Programming (OOP). Maybe you want to create an array of Objects, each with a fair number of variables. This memory adds up quite fast. And to make things worse, an array of memory is all contiguous; the memory is all in one solid chunk.

A way around this solid chunk of memory is, yes you guessed it, a linked list. The beauty of a linked list is that it does not have to have contiguous memory. The different objects, typically called nodes, each contain a link variable. This link points to the next item in the list, where it may be in memory. Think about it kind of like a puzzle. You typically would not store a puzzle completely built because those "contiguous pieces" are bulky and hard to store; and if you wanted just one you've got to take them all. So instead, you break the puzzle apart, because you know each piece link to the next one piece. This way you can work with just the piece you want and still keep track of the rest.

Another great advantage to linked lists is that they are customized to exactly what you want. A linked list is not typically something included in a programming language, it is something that you build yourself. This may be a bit bit more difficult than using an array, or even an arrayList, but it proves itself in power.

If anyone has any questions about Linked Lists, feel free to ask on the forum. Either I will help you personally or someone else will. …

Vlans

In order to implement VLANs in a network environment, you'll need a Layer 2 switch that supports them. Almost all switches sold today that are described as "managed" switches provide the ability to make ports members of different VLANs. However, switches that do not provide any configuration function (such as many basic, lower-end switches) do not provide the ability to configure VLANs. Almost any Cisco Catalyst switch that you'll come across today provides the ability to make ports part of different VLANs.

Before getting into the details of how a VLAN functions, it's worth exploring some of the advantages that a VLAN provides. First and foremost, VLANs provide the ability to define broadcast domains without the constraint of physical location. For example, instead of making all of the users on the third floor part of the same broadcast domain, you may use VLANs to make all of the users in the HR department part of the same broadcast domain. The benefits of doing this are many. Firstly, these users might be spread through different floors on a building, so a VLAN would allow you to make all of these users part of the same broadcast domain. To that end, this can also be viewed as a security feature – since all HR users are part of the same broadcast domain, you could later use policies such as access lists to control which areas of the network these users have access to, or which Users have access to the HR broadcast domain. Furthermore, if the HR department's server were placed on the same VLAN, HR users would be able to access their server without the need for traffic to cross routers and potentially impact other parts of the network.

VLANs are defined on a switch on a port-by-port basis. That is, you may choose to make ports 1-6 part of VLAN 1, and ports 7-12 part of VLAN 2. There's no need for ports in the same VLAN to be contiguous at all – you could make ports 1, 3 and 5 on a switch part of VLAN 1, for example. On almost all switches today, all ports are part of VLAN 1 by default. If you want to implement additional VLANs, these must first be defined in the switch's software (such as the IOS on a Cisco switch), and then ports must be made members of that VLAN. A VLAN is not limited to a single switch, either. If trunk links are used to interconnect switches, a VLAN might have 3 ports on one switch, and 7 ports on another, as shown below. The logical nature of a VLAN makes it a very effective tool, especially in larger networking environments.

Inter-VLAN Communication

I mentioned a few times already that a VLAN is simply a special type of broadcast domain, in that it is defined on a switch port basis rather than traditional physical boundaries. Recall from the earlier articles in this series that when a host in one broadcast domain …